Rīga Stradiņš University has opened a new sports, study and research centre in Pārdaugava, creating a shared base for sports education, practical training, university teams and research into human physical performance.
The facility at 3 Cigoriņu Street was officially opened on Wednesday, 9 September 2026. The project gives RSU and its Academy of Sport a modern setting in which classroom knowledge, physical activity and applied research can operate side by side. The university says the centre is also intended to serve academic staff, employees and members of the surrounding community who want to take part in sport.
A university facility with several purposes
The centre covers 3,627 square metres and represents an investment of almost €13.4 million. According to RSU and the Latvian research information portal Research Latvia, the project was financed through university resources together with co-financing from the European Union’s Recovery and Resilience Facility.
Its main sports hall is designed for basketball and volleyball. The building also includes a gym with strength, cardio and functional-training areas, rooms for gymnastics, Pilates and yoga, and a multifunctional hall for group activities and other uses.
For students, however, the most significant element may be the infrastructure dedicated to teaching and research. The centre includes a scientific laboratory for measuring human-body and physical parameters, physiotherapy rooms and a medical point. These spaces are intended to support practical instruction for students of the RSU Academy of Sport, as well as research connected with health, movement and athletic performance.
From theory to practical experience
The opening comes at an important moment for sports education at RSU. The former Latvian Academy of Sport Education became part of Rīga Stradiņš University in July 2024 and began operating under the name RSU Academy of Sport on 1 September 2026. The academy traces its institutional history back to 1921, when Latvia established its first higher-education institution specialising in sport.
RSU says the new building will allow students to complement theoretical studies with practical experience in a purpose-built environment. That can include instruction in sports pedagogy, physiotherapy, exercise assessment and health-related physical activity. The combination is particularly relevant to a university whose wider profile includes medicine, healthcare and social sciences.
The facility also gives university sports teams a permanent location for training and home competitions. Previously, RSU’s sports infrastructure was spread across older or less suitable premises. Consolidating activities in one centre is expected to make training, teaching and university sport easier to coordinate.
Research connected to everyday health
The new laboratory gives the centre a role beyond conventional university sports provision. Measuring physical and physiological parameters can support studies of exercise, recovery, rehabilitation and the relationship between physical activity and public health. The building’s physiotherapy facilities add another practical dimension, linking sports science with injury prevention and recovery.
That approach reflects a broader trend in health education: research is increasingly expected to produce knowledge that can be used in everyday settings, from schools and amateur clubs to clinical practice and community health programmes. RSU’s sports research structures already cover topics including physical activity, nutrition, psychological adaptation and the health of young people.
The university has also emphasised accessibility in the design of the complex. The building includes a lift, adapted sanitary facilities and universal-design solutions. Bicycle and electric-mobility parking spaces are provided as part of the site’s infrastructure.
An opening with a local dimension
RSU has presented the centre not only as an internal university investment but also as a place with a role in the surrounding neighbourhood. Local residents are expected to be invited to selected activities, while the university plans to use the facility to promote healthy lifestyles and public engagement with sport.
For Pārdaugava, the project adds a specialised educational and research site close to Arkādijas Park. For Latvia’s higher-education system, it offers a visible example of infrastructure designed to serve several functions at once: student learning, applied science, organised sport and public health.
